The Material Science Behind the Crafting Craze
The surging demand for sandnes garn line yarn stems from its unique structural composition. Combining linen for crispness, cotton for structural integrity, and viscose for a subtle, elegant drape creates a distinct tactile experience that standard 100% wool or acrylic alternatives cannot replicate. Knitters transitioning away heavy winter garments find this specific fiber blend offers the ideal balance of stitch definition and fluid movement.

Securing Stock and Mastering Gauge Ratios
Acquiring popular colorways requires strategic timing as independent yarn stores and major online distributors experience rolling inventory bottlenecks. Crafters are advised to monitor dye lots closely when planning larger garments to avoid subtle color variations between skeins. Because linen and viscose blends behave differently than traditional animal fibers, swatching and wet blocking before casting on a major project remain essential steps for accurate sizing.
